Stackable container with protrusion and groove
10246221 · 2019-04-02 ·

A container features a pair of stacking features on its top and bottom walls enabling a plurality of such containers to be disposed in a vertically stacked configuration. One of these stacking features is a protrusion with a tip spaced from an outer surface of the respective wall and opposite sides depending from the tip on either side thereof towards the wall's outer surface, and the other one is a groove with a base recessed from an outer surface of the respective wall and opposite sides of the groove extending from the base on either side thereof towards the wall's outer surface. The groove of one such container is thus arranged to matingly receive the protrusion of another such container so that the two containers are interconnectable in the vertically stacked configuration.

Beverage container
10227158 · 2019-03-12 ·

An improved drinking can enables a user to have fluid return into the can after drinking The improved drinking can comprises a can body comprising a contoured bottom edge immediately adjacent to a bottom recess. The can body further comprising a can top mechanically coupled to a spout. Where the spout is shaped to funnel fluid back into the can body. The bottom recess is shaped to enable a first improved drinking can to sit upon a second improved drinking can where bottom recess covers can top. This protects the drinking area from becoming contaminated during shipment, storage, and display. The can body is covered with a mural where the mural is covered by a mural cover comprising a tab such that the mural cover can be removed by applying force to the tab displaying the mural.

STACKABLE STORAGE DEVICE FOR HEADWEAR
20190031428 · 2019-01-31 ·

A storage device for headwear that includes an elongated container with side surfaces, top and bottom surfaces and a back surface that also features a drawer that can be slid in and out of the container through an opening at one end of the container. The opening is covered by a door featuring a magnet whose polarity is opposite that of another magnet embedded in the bottom surface of the container. The devices can be stacked one on top of another and magnets in the door of one device and the bottom surface of another device hold the door of one of the devices open. The container features one or more stops that contact the walls of the drawer to prevent it from being pulled out of the container. A horizontal flange limits the vertical movement of the drawer and cooperates with the stops to hold the drawer in place.

TOOLBOX
20190009403 · 2019-01-10 ·

A toolbox is disclosed, comprising a case having two shells, wherein one of the two shells is formed with several strips which are crossed at right angles, and several containers put in the case and formed with several notches at a bottom edge of a body of the container to engage with the strips of the shell for positioning the container. Therefore, the containers can be put at any position in the toolbox by corresponding the strips which are crossed at right angles at the shell to the notches at the container's bottom, increasing the convenience of the positioning of the containers. Besides, when the containers are stacked with each other, the notches at the outer bottom of the body of the upper container is engaged with pegs on the lid of the lower container for positioning, thereby increasing the stability in the stacked condition.

DEVICE FOR STORING, TRANSPORTING AND/OR HANDLING A LIQUID AND METHOD OF HANDLING A STERILE OR ASEPTIC LIQUID
20190002176 · 2019-01-03 ·

A device for storing, transporting and/or handling a liquid or liquids and methods for using the device are described. The device is suitable for use with sterile or aseptic liquids, particularly with large liquid volumes such as 10-1000 liters or more, and avoids the need for bags, bins and carriers commonly used for storing and transporting large volumes of liquids. The device comprises a coiled tubing. The coiled tubing can be loaded onto a spool to support the coiled tubing. The tubing can be filled, sealed, stored and transported in a more robust manner than previously achieved with bags, bins and carriers.

CONTAINER FOR THE SHIPMENT AND DISPLAY OF A PRODUCT
20240286793 · 2024-08-29 ·

A container for the shipment and display of a product includes a corrugated plastic sleeve that is selectively enclosed by a pair of opposing plastic trays. The sleeve includes four adjacent panels that together define open top and bottom ends. Alignment tabs are formed on the top and bottom ends of the sleeve and fittingly protrude into complementary slots in each tray to help retain container in an assembled condition. Each tray includes a rectangular plate and an outer continuous wall which protrudes from the peripheral edge of the plate at an obtuse angle, which enables multiple trays to be arranged as a nested stack. A plurality of thru-holes is provided in the sleeve for ventilation and is arranged so that select thru-holes in adjacent panels axially align when the sleeve is collapsed into a flattened condition, thereby facilitating the stacking of used sleeves onto posts for subsequent cleaning.
